The gpredict source package is small (4MBytes).  That's downloadable
even at 33kbps, I would hope!

rmadison shows:

    gpredict |      1.1-7 | maverick/universe | source, amd64, i386

Download that source package, compile it on whatever Ubuntu you now
have, and see whether it fixes the issue for you.  Try:

  dget
http://archive.ubuntu.com/ubuntu/pool/universe/g/gpredict/gpredict_1.1-7.dsc
  cd gpredict-1.1
  debuild

and then see how much fixup you need to do to get it to build :)
